Output 74377f456aefc17943837412f5fd217f81b8c2a0ef7c307470b47e1c26869a63:0

value
25950659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4020fd1fe7293293813330b0a25f584ff7a77e04 OP_EQUALVERIFY OP_CHECKSIG
address
16r5mNs1Phj8yAnHL2PUKxPa5sN46ryZNR
transaction
74377f456aefc17943837412f5fd217f81b8c2a0ef7c307470b47e1c26869a63
spent
true